(Disclaimer: Myriad Markets is a product of Decrypt’s parent company, DASTAN.) Will Strategy (MSTR) purchase Bitcoin this week? Market Opened: April 29 Closes: May 5 Volume: $9.82K Over the last few years, it’s been difficult to keep Michael Saylor and his firm Strategy (formerly MicroStrategy) from the Bitcoin buy button, as the company has amassed a treasury with more than 2.6% of the total BTC supply. A new market on Myriad allows predictors to decide whether or not he and his firm will push it once more in the weeklong span ending May 5. So far, predictors are overwhelmingly in favor of “yes” with odds of 85.2% as of Thursday afternoon. Why might predictors feel so certain? Perhaps it’s because the firm rarely takes breaks from buying Bitcoin. Since the year began, Strategy has already announced 12 separate Bitcoin purchases, including earlier this week when it announced the addition of $1.4 billion worth to bring its total holdings to 553,555 BTC—more than $53 billion worth. Strategy also bought Bitcoin in each of the previous weeks and has only taken a handful of two-week breaks in between purchase disclosures so far this year. While Saylor’s firm has engaged in creative financing to create funds for Bitcoin purchases, as of April 27, the company was down to around $129 million of MSTR shares for issuance and sale. This puts it near the limit for one of its equity offering programs announced in October . However, the firm still maintains nearly $21 billion in available issuance for its STRK offering. So will Saylor and company purchase again in the coming week? Predictors think so, with only a 14.8% chance of the company not doing so, according to the latest Myriad flash market. Market Open: April 21 Closes: May 19 Volume: $16K Around 180 cardinals present in Rome agreed to start the conclave, or the papal election assembly, on May 7 to select the next pope. During the conclave, eligible cardinal electors will cast secret ballots to try and determine Pope Francis’ successor, needing a two-thirds majority to do so. If a two-thirds agreement is reached, then the next Pope is selected and the chimney above the Sistine Chapel produces “white smoke.” Should there not be an agreement, then it instead will emit black smoke. In other words, predictors in this market are attempting to determine whether or not the next pope will be decided in the first two days of secret ballots. But two days of voting doesn’t mean there will be just two votes. According to Vatican News , if voting begins in the afternoon of May 7, then there will be just one ballot. But if it continues into May 8, the second day of the conclave, then there will be four ballots in total —two each in the morning and afternoon. Predictors on Myriad are close to split about the cardinals’ ability to reach two-thirds majority in the first two days, with odds of “no” slightly edging out “yes” at 51.4% to 48.6%. But the odds have gotten tighter as the week has progressed, moving 7.8% in both directions during that time. While there is no definitive timetable for the conclave, if the cardinal electors are unable to reach a two-thirds majority after three days, then they are able to take a one-day break and conduct free discussion. Market Open: April 22 Closes: May 31 Volume: $76.5K Myriad’s highest-volume prediction market magnifies Jerome Powell’s actions once more, this time asking if Powell will leave his Fed chair position before June. Sworn in for a second four-year term in May 2022 , Powell technically has another year left in the office, but this market resolves “yes” for any departure of the role, including firings—a topic President Trump has hinted at in posts on Truth Social. “Powell’s termination cannot come fast enough!,” the President posted on April 17, once more referring to him as “Mr. Too Late” in the same post. But days later, Trump said he had no intention of firing Powell , and predictors appear to believe him. At present time, the market stands at 93.6% odds of “no” for Powell leaving before June, suggesting Trump will not be the first president to fire the Fed chair since the central bank became independent in 1951 .
